Explorer_通过Explorer调试API

Explorer API 允许开发者在 Windows Explorer 中集成自定义操作和数据处理。通过使用 C++ 或 .NET,可创建 shell 扩展来增强文件管理功能,如添加右键菜单项、自定义图标等。

通过Explorer调试API

Explorer_通过Explorer调试API
(图片来源网络,侵删)

调试API是开发人员在开发过程中必不可少的工具,它可以帮助我们找到并修复代码中的错误,在这篇文章中,我们将详细介绍如何使用Explorer来调试API。

什么是Explorer?

Explorer是一个强大的API测试工具,它可以帮助开发人员快速创建、运行和调试API,Explorer提供了直观的用户界面,使得开发人员可以轻松地发送请求、查看响应、修改参数等,Explorer还支持多种认证方式,如OAuth2、API Key等,以满足不同API的需求。

如何通过Explorer调试API?

1. 创建一个新的API请求

打开Explorer并点击“新建”按钮创建一个新API请求,在弹出的对话框中,输入请求的名称、URL、方法(GET、POST、PUT、DELETE等)以及任何需要的参数。

{
  "name": "My API Request",
  "url": "https://api.example.com/users",
  "method": "GET"
}

2. 添加认证信息

如果你的API需要认证,你可以在“认证”选项卡中添加相应的认证信息,如果你使用的是OAuth2认证,你需要提供Client ID、Client Secret、Access Token URL等信息。

Explorer_通过Explorer调试API
(图片来源网络,侵删)
{
  "type": "OAuth2",
  "clientId": "your_client_id",
  "clientSecret": "your_client_secret",
  "accessTokenUrl": "https://api.example.com/oauth2/token"
}

3. 发送请求并查看响应

完成以上步骤后,点击“发送”按钮发送请求,在“响应”选项卡中,你可以查看API返回的数据,如果返回的数据是JSON格式,Explorer会自动将其格式化以便于阅读。

{
  "statusCode": 200,
  "data": {
    "users": [
      {
        "id": 1,
        "name": "John Doe",
        "email": "john.doe@example.com"
      },
      {
        "id": 2,
        "name": "Jane Doe",
        "email": "jane.doe@example.com"
      }
    ]
  }
}

4. 修改参数并再次发送请求

如果你需要修改请求的参数或者尝试不同的参数组合,你可以直接在“参数”选项卡中进行修改,然后再次发送请求。

{
  "name": "My API Request",
  "url": "https://api.example.com/users?page=2",
  "method": "GET"
}

问题与解答

1、如果API返回了错误信息,我应该如何排查?

答:如果API返回了错误信息,你可以先检查你的请求是否正确,包括URL、参数、认证信息等,如果这些都正确,那么可能是API服务器的问题,你可以尝试联系API提供者获取帮助。

2、我可以使用Explorer来测试哪些类型的API?

Explorer_通过Explorer调试API
(图片来源网络,侵删)

答:你可以使用Explorer来测试几乎所有类型的API,包括但不限于RESTful API、SOAP API、GraphQL API等,只要你能提供正确的URL、参数和认证信息,Explorer就能帮助你发送请求并查看响应。

【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!

(0)
热舞的头像热舞
上一篇 2024-07-14 21:20
下一篇 2024-07-14 21:26

相关推荐

  • vivo手机突然服务器错误连接不上,是官方维护还是我网络问题?

    探究错误根源:vivo服务器错误为何发生?vivo服务器错误,本质上是您的手机与vivo官方服务器之间的通信中断或失败,这种通信失败通常可以归咎于三大类原因:用户端网络问题、应用或系统层面问题,以及vivo服务器自身的问题,用户端网络环境不稳定:这是最常见的原因,无论您使用的是Wi-Fi还是移动数据,如果信号微……

    2025-10-10
    0054
  • 服务器推送消息给app

    服务器通过第三方服务(如APNs、FCM)向App推送消息,需App注册设备标识,消息可触发弹窗提醒或静默更新内容,依赖网络连接,支持跨平台实时触达用户

    2025-05-03
    006
  • 萍乡监控服务器如何保障数据安全与稳定运行?

    在信息化时代,数据安全与系统稳定性成为企业运营的核心命题,萍乡地区作为江西省重要的工业城市,制造业、服务业等产业的数字化转型需求迫切,对监控服务器的性能、可靠性与本地化支持提出了更高要求,本文将从萍乡监控服务器的应用场景、技术选型、运维管理及发展趋势等方面展开探讨,为当地企业提供参考,萍乡监控服务器的核心应用场……

    2025-10-17
    004
  • 火影服务器崩掉?网友,我的忍界情缘是否将终止?

    影响与应对措施火影服务器突然崩掉,导致大量玩家无法正常登录游戏,这一事件引起了广大玩家的关注和不满,同时也对游戏运营方提出了更高的要求,影响分析玩家体验受损火影服务器崩掉导致玩家无法正常登录游戏,严重影响了玩家的游戏体验,许多玩家在等待修复过程中,纷纷表示对游戏运营方的失望,游戏经济受损服务器崩掉使得游戏内的交……

    2026-01-30
    0010

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

广告合作

QQ:14239236

在线咨询: QQ交谈

邮件:asy@cxas.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信